Cary Posavitz has been performing professionally since the age of 17 in a variety of shows and venues all over the world. Cary & the Players featured weekly at the iconic Shelbourne Hotel's Jazz brunch for the past six years. He spent four years in Riverdance, the Irish Dancing international phenomenon, as a featured singer. In the USA, Cary starred in Joseph and the Amazing Technicolour Dreamcoat, had lead roles in Cruisin’ ’57 for Dick Clark Productions, The Magnificent Gospel Showcase for Sky Television, was featured entertainer for Regency, Radisson, Celebrity Cruise Lines, and the Showboat Branson Belle, as well as being featured with the sensational Celtic Woman for their PBS Television Special and DVD release. Cary is currently fronting his highly successful band, Cary Posavitz and the Players, performing across Ireland and abroad.
Voice of the Quiet Man, an album of 6 songs by the late composer Richard Farrelly, and performed by “jazz crooner”, Cary Posavitz. The original songs were written from the 1940’s to the 1980’s, and include The Isle of Innisfree (theme song used for the film The Quiet Man), We Dreamed our Dreams, and If You Ever Fall in Love Again.
